Open Bug 1893353 Opened 9 months ago Updated 8 months ago

Startup crash in [@ nsAutoRefCnt::operator++]

Categories

(Core :: XPCOM, defect)

Other
All
defect

Tracking

()

Tracking Status
firefox127 --- affected

People

(Reporter: release-mgmt-account-bot, Unassigned)

References

(Blocks 1 open bug)

Details

(Keywords: crash)

Crash Data

Crash report: https://crash-stats.mozilla.org/report/index/07215def-6667-400d-b751-7aeb80240424

Reason: EXCEPTION_ILLEGAL_INSTRUCTION

Top 10 frames of crashing thread:

0  xul.dll  nsAutoRefCnt::operator++  xpcom/base/nsISupportsImpl.h:354
0  xul.dll  nsAboutCache::Channel::AddRef  dom/media/webrtc/common/browser_logging/WebRtcLog.cpp:69
1  xul.dll  mozilla::RefPtrTraits<nsIToolkitProfile>::AddRef  mfbt/RefPtr.h:48
1  xul.dll  nsCOMPtr<nsIToolkitProfile>::assign_with_AddRef  xpcom/base/nsCOMPtr.h:811
1  xul.dll  nsCOMPtr<nsIToolkitProfile>::operator=  xpcom/base/nsCOMPtr.h:591
1  xul.dll  nsToolkitProfileService::Init  toolkit/profile/nsToolkitProfileService.cpp:1031
2  xul.dll  NS_GetToolkitProfileService  toolkit/profile/nsToolkitProfileService.cpp:2189
3  xul.dll  XREMain::XRE_mainStartup  toolkit/xre/nsAppRunner.cpp:4870
4  xul.dll  XREMain::XRE_main  toolkit/xre/nsAppRunner.cpp:5946
5  xul.dll  XRE_main  toolkit/xre/nsAppRunner.cpp:6015

By querying Nightly crashes reported within the last 2 months, here are some insights about the signature:

  • First crash report: 2024-04-08
  • Process type: Multiple distinct types
  • Is startup crash: Yes - 7 out of 8 crashes happened during startup
  • Has user comments: No
  • Is null crash: Yes - 2 out of 8 crashes happened on null or near null memory address
Component: General → WebRTC
Flags: needinfo?(na-g)

This signature has placed numerous, unrelated, low frequency crashes in the same bucket. WebRTC does not seem to be particularly representative of the crash population.

Flags: needinfo?(na-g)

I've looked at this, and this is not happening in any one place consistently. I have not found a webrtc related instance. If someone has seen one, please send a link so I can file a more specific bug.

Assignee: nobody → docfaraday
Component: WebRTC → General
Assignee: docfaraday → nobody
Severity: -- → S4
Component: General → XPCOM
You need to log in before you can comment on or make changes to this bug.